Agreed. Now that bounties are THE way for leveling up, it should be looked at. At least taking into account players picking up Vanguard, Gambit, and Crucible bounties daily. Part of the problem is that quests are still tied to the max number for bounties. It is 63 max for bounties and quests. Now that we are getting a decent number of quests again, it bogs down the number of bounties you can get. I think 50 or 60 bounties would be reasonable. You don't want to go too high since it would allow for hoarding bounties going into a new season for xp.

You can hold up to 63 quests and/or bounties. So my suggestion is to delete quests you aren't actively pursuing (pick them up at the vendor later) so that you have more room for daily bounties.
